Baron Pál Esterházy de Galántha 1587 – 1645

Hungarian noble, son of Vice-ispán of Pozsony County Ferenc Esterházy. He was the founder of the Zólyom branch of the House of Esterházy. His brother was, among others, Nikolaus, Count Esterházy who served as Palatine of Hungary:

Johann IV. Graf Pálffy von Erdöd

The House of Pálffy ab Erdöd, also known as Pálffy von Erdöd, Pálffy de Erdöd, or Pálffy of Erdöd, is the name of a Hungarian noble family. Members of the family held significant positions in the Habsburg monarchy. Erdőd is the Hungarian name for Ardud, a town situated in Transylvania.

Isabella Clara Eugenia of Austria 1566-1633

Isabella Clara Eugenia, sometimes referred to as Clara Isabella Eugenia, was sovereign of the Spanish Netherlands in the Low Countries and the north of modern France with her husband, Archduke Albert VII of Austria. Their reign is considered the Golden Age of the Spanish Netherlands.

Archduchess Margaret of Austria 1536-1567

“Margarita Ertzherzogin zu Österreich, daughter of Holy Roman Emperor Ferdinand I and Anne of Bohemia and Hungary and a member of the Habsburg House. Along with her sister Magdalena, Margaret became a nun in Hall in Tirol, a town in the Innsbruck-Land district of the Tyrol.
